p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c Move swfdec and swfdec-gtk2 from graphics to multimedia.



details:   https://anonhg.NetBSD.org/pkgsrc/rev/b33914e2ec86
branches:  trunk
changeset: 495192:b33914e2ec86
user:      jmmv <jmmv%pkgsrc.org@localhost>
date:      Sat Jun 04 10:41:41 2005 +0000

description:
Move swfdec and swfdec-gtk2 from graphics to multimedia.
Suggested by wiz@.

diffstat:

 doc/CHANGES                        |   4 +-
 graphics/Makefile                  |   4 +-
 graphics/swfdec-gtk2/DESCR         |   6 ---
 graphics/swfdec-gtk2/Makefile      |  20 -----------
 graphics/swfdec-gtk2/PLIST         |   3 -
 graphics/swfdec/DESCR              |   7 ----
 graphics/swfdec/MESSAGE            |   7 ----
 graphics/swfdec/Makefile           |  13 -------
 graphics/swfdec/Makefile.common    |  25 --------------
 graphics/swfdec/PLIST              |   7 ----
 graphics/swfdec/buildlink3.mk      |  23 -------------
 graphics/swfdec/distinfo           |   8 ----
 graphics/swfdec/patches/patch-aa   |  12 -------
 graphics/swfdec/patches/patch-ab   |  65 --------------------------------------
 graphics/swfdec/patches/patch-ac   |  24 --------------
 meta-pkgs/gtk2-extras/Makefile     |   4 +-
 multimedia/Makefile                |   4 +-
 multimedia/swfdec-gtk2/DESCR       |   6 +++
 multimedia/swfdec-gtk2/Makefile    |  20 +++++++++++
 multimedia/swfdec-gtk2/PLIST       |   3 +
 multimedia/swfdec/DESCR            |   7 ++++
 multimedia/swfdec/MESSAGE          |   7 ++++
 multimedia/swfdec/Makefile         |  13 +++++++
 multimedia/swfdec/Makefile.common  |  25 ++++++++++++++
 multimedia/swfdec/PLIST            |   7 ++++
 multimedia/swfdec/buildlink3.mk    |  23 +++++++++++++
 multimedia/swfdec/distinfo         |   8 ++++
 multimedia/swfdec/patches/patch-aa |  12 +++++++
 multimedia/swfdec/patches/patch-ab |  65 ++++++++++++++++++++++++++++++++++++++
 multimedia/swfdec/patches/patch-ac |  24 ++++++++++++++
 30 files changed, 229 insertions(+), 227 deletions(-)

diffs (truncated from 613 to 300 lines):

diff -r d3df9cadaf32 -r b33914e2ec86 doc/CHANGES
--- a/doc/CHANGES       Sat Jun 04 10:20:22 2005 +0000
+++ b/doc/CHANGES       Sat Jun 04 10:41:41 2005 +0000
@@ -1,4 +1,4 @@
-$NetBSD: CHANGES,v 1.10288 2005/06/04 09:36:23 wiz Exp $
+$NetBSD: CHANGES,v 1.10289 2005/06/04 10:41:41 jmmv Exp $
 
 Changes to the packages collection and infrastructure in 2005:
        
@@ -2777,3 +2777,5 @@
        Added comms/conserver8 version 8.1.11 [wiz 2005-06-03]
        Updated security/systrace-policies to 1.1nb1 [kristerw 2005-06-04]
        Updated net/rsync to 2.6.5 [wiz 2005-06-04]
+       Moved graphics/swfdec to multimedia/swfdec [jmmv 2005-06-04]
+       Moved graphics/swfdec-gtk2 to multimedia/swfdec-gtk2 [jmmv 2005-06-04]
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/Makefile
--- a/graphics/Makefile Sat Jun 04 10:20:22 2005 +0000
+++ b/graphics/Makefile Sat Jun 04 10:41:41 2005 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.384 2005/05/18 22:39:00 wiz Exp $
+# $NetBSD: Makefile,v 1.385 2005/06/04 10:41:41 jmmv Exp $
 #
 
 COMMENT=       Graphics tools and libraries
@@ -261,8 +261,6 @@
 SUBDIR+=       snx101view
 SUBDIR+=       sodipodi
 SUBDIR+=       spcaview
-SUBDIR+=       swfdec
-SUBDIR+=       swfdec-gtk2
 SUBDIR+=       tgif
 SUBDIR+=       tiff
 SUBDIR+=       tkpiechart
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ec-gtk2/DESCR
--- a/graphics/swfdec-gtk2/DESCR        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,6 +0,0 @@
-Swfdec is a library for rendering Flash(R) animations and games.  It was
-originally designed as a basis library for creating Flash plugins for
-GStreamer, but it is a fully standalone library which only use the libart
-library for drawing.  Swfdec is released under the LGPL.
-
-This package provides an SWF based pixbuf-loader for GTK.
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ec-gtk2/Makefile
--- a/graphics/swfdec-gtk2/Makefile     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,20 +0,0 @@
-# $NetBSD: Makefile,v 1.7 2005/03/27 15:43:37 wiz Exp $
-#
-
-PKGREVISION=           2
-
-.include "../../graphics/swfdec/Makefile.common"
-
-PKGNAME=               ${DISTNAME:S/-/-gtk2-/}
-COMMENT+=              (GTK2 modules)
-
-CONFIGURE_ARGS+=       --enable-pixbuf-loader
-
-BUILD_DIRS=            ${WRKSRC}/pixbuf-loader
-INSTALL_DIRS=          ${WRKSRC}/pixbuf-loader
-
-GTK2_LOADERS=          YES
-
-.include "../../graphics/swfdec/buildlink3.mk"
-.include "../../x11/gtk2/modules.mk"
-.include "../../mk/bsd.pkg.mk"
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ec-gtk2/PLIST
--- a/graphics/swfdec-gtk2/PLIST        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,3 +0,0 @@
-@comment $NetBSD: PLIST,v 1.3 2004/09/22 08:09:38 jlam Exp $
-lib/gtk-2.0/2.4.0/loaders/swf_loader.la
-@comment in gtk2: @dirrm lib/gtk-2.0/2.4.0/loaders
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/DESCR
--- a/graphics/swfdec/DESCR     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,7 +0,0 @@
-Swfdec is a library for rendering Flash(R) animations and games.  It was
-originally designed as a basis library for creating Flash plugins for
-GStreamer, but it is a fully standalone library which only use the libart
-library for drawing.  Swfdec is released under the LGPL.
-
-This package provides the swfdec library, as well as an standalone SWF
-player.
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/MESSAGE
--- a/graphics/swfdec/MESSAGE   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,7 +0,0 @@
-===========================================================================
-$NetBSD: MESSAGE,v 1.3 2004/01/22 12:48:32 jmmv Exp $
-
-You should install the swfdec-gtk2 package, which provides an SWF
-gdk-pixbuf loader for the GTK2 toolkit.
-
-===========================================================================
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/Makefile
--- a/graphics/swfdec/Makefile  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,13 +0,0 @@
-# $NetBSD: Makefile,v 1.16 2005/03/27 15:43:37 wiz Exp $
-#
-
-PKGREVISION=           2
-
-.include "Makefile.common"
-
-CONFIGURE_ARGS+=       --disable-pixbuf-loader
-
-.include "../../devel/SDL/buildlink3.mk"
-.include "../../graphics/libart2/buildlink3.mk"
-.include "../../x11/gtk2/buildlink3.mk"
-.include "../../mk/bsd.pkg.mk"
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/Makefile.common
--- a/graphics/swfdec/Makefile.common   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,25 +0,0 @@
-# $NetBSD: Makefile.common,v 1.8 2005/06/04 00:21:05 wiz Exp $
-#
-
-DISTNAME=              swfdec-0.2.2
-CATEGORIES=            graphics
-MASTER_SITES=          ${MASTER_SITE_SOURCEFORGE:=swfdec/}
-
-MAINTAINER=            jmmv%NetBSD.org@localhost
-HOMEPAGE=              http://swfdec.sourceforge.net/
-COMMENT=               Library for rendering Flash(R) animations and games
-
-DISTINFO_FILE=         ${.CURDIR}/../../graphics/swfdec/distinfo
-PATCHDIR=              ${.CURDIR}/../../graphics/swfdec/patches
-
-GNU_CONFIGURE=         yes
-USE_PKGINSTALL=                yes
-USE_PKGLOCALEDIR=      yes
-USE_LIBTOOL=           yes
-
-PKGCONFIG_OVERRIDE=    swfdec.pc.in
-
-pre-install:
-       ${ECHO} "install:" >${WRKSRC}/plugin/Makefile
-
-.include "../../devel/pkgconfig/buildlink3.mk"
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/PLIST
--- a/graphics/swfdec/PLIST     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,7 +0,0 @@
-@comment $NetBSD: PLIST,v 1.4 2004/09/22 08:09:38 jlam Exp $
-bin/swf_play
-include/swfdec/swf.h
-include/swfdec/swfdec.h
-lib/libswfdec.la
-lib/pkgconfig/swfdec.pc
-@dirrm include/swfdec
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/buildlink3.mk
--- a/graphics/swfdec/buildlink3.mk     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,23 +0,0 @@
-# $NetBSD: buildlink3.mk,v 1.5 2004/10/03 00:14:58 tv Exp $
-
-BUILDLINK_DEPTH:=      ${BUILDLINK_DEPTH}+
-SWFDEC_BUILDLINK3_MK:= ${SWFDEC_BUILDLINK3_MK}+
-
-.if !empty(BUILDLINK_DEPTH:M+)
-BUILDLINK_DEPENDS+=    swfdec
-.endif
-
-BUILDLINK_PACKAGES:=   ${BUILDLINK_PACKAGES:Nswfdec}
-BUILDLINK_PACKAGES+=   swfdec
-
-.if !empty(SWFDEC_BUILDLINK3_MK:M+)
-BUILDLINK_DEPENDS.swfdec+=     swfdec>=0.2.2
-BUILDLINK_RECOMMENDED.swfdec+= swfdec>=0.2.2nb1
-BUILDLINK_PKGSRCDIR.swfdec?=   ../../graphics/swfdec
-.endif # SWFDEC_BUILDLINK3_MK
-
-.include "../../devel/SDL/buildlink3.mk"
-.include "../../graphics/libart2/buildlink3.mk"
-.include "../../x11/gtk2/buildlink3.mk"
-
-BUILDLINK_DEPTH:=     ${BUILDLINK_DEPTH:S/+$//}
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/distinfo
--- a/graphics/swfdec/distinfo  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,8 +0,0 @@
-$NetBSD: distinfo,v 1.7 2005/02/24 08:45:13 agc Exp $
-
-SHA1 (swfdec-0.2.2.tar.gz) = f3cbc3fec455117d554d37ac4dda1d99fb592661
-RMD160 (swfdec-0.2.2.tar.gz) = e44e1d5890fd1b8e6b73fa0ed5d645dbb6203c88
-Size (swfdec-0.2.2.tar.gz) = 332280 bytes
-SHA1 (patch-aa) = ae2cd8ffb34d09c709378cc3b45510cb5d738305
-SHA1 (patch-ab) = 2a2a6b335ddb0ebce2aee38eb004d4b6e26f19b7
-SHA1 (patch-ac) = 96a9a5275e297088f326b729fde3feef79b323aa
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/patches/patch-aa
--- a/graphics/swfdec/patches/patch-aa  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,12 +0,0 @@
-$NetBSD: patch-aa,v 1.1.1.1 2003/04/23 08:15:40 rh Exp $
-
---- libswfdec/mpglib/clipconv_f32_s16.h.orig   2002-11-06 17:11:48.000000000 +1000
-+++ libswfdec/mpglib/clipconv_f32_s16.h
-@@ -34,7 +34,6 @@ Half integers may be rounded to either n
- //#include <sl_altivec.h>
- #define f32 float
- #define s16 short
--#define HAVE_IEEE754_H
- 
- 
- /* storage class */
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/patches/patch-ab
--- a/graphics/swfdec/patches/patch-ab  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,65 +0,0 @@
-$NetBSD: patch-ab,v 1.3 2003/05/12 20:17:48 jmc Exp $
-
---- player/swf_play.c.orig     Wed Feb  5 20:19:27 2003
-+++ player/swf_play.c  Mon May 12 11:43:12 2003
-@@ -15,6 +15,8 @@
- #include <signal.h>
- #include <sys/wait.h>
- #include <sys/time.h>
-+#include <sys/signal.h>
-+#include <errno.h>
- #include <time.h>
- #include <string.h>
- 
-@@ -72,6 +74,15 @@
- static gboolean render_idle(gpointer data);
- 
- /* fault handling stuff */
-+#ifndef SI_USER
-+typedef struct {
-+        char *si_addr;
-+        int si_signo;
-+        int si_errno;
-+        int si_code;
-+} siginfo_t;
-+#endif
-+
- void fault_handler(int signum, siginfo_t *si, void *misc);
- void fault_restore(void);
- void fault_setup(void);
-@@ -539,6 +550,20 @@
-       _exit(0);
- }
- 
-+#ifndef SI_USER
-+void si_handler(int sig, int code, struct sigcontext *scp)
-+{
-+      siginfo_t si;
-+
-+      si.si_addr = NULL;
-+      si.si_signo = sig;
-+      si.si_errno = errno;
-+      si.si_code = code;
-+
-+      fault_handler(sig, &si, scp);
-+}
-+#endif
-+
- void fault_restore(void)
- {
-       struct sigaction action;
-@@ -555,8 +580,13 @@
-       struct sigaction action;
- 
-       memset(&action,0,sizeof(action));
-+#ifdef SI_USER
-       action.sa_sigaction = fault_handler;
--      action.sa_flags = SA_SIGINFO;
-+      action.sa_flags = 0;
-+#else
-+      action.sa_handler = (void (*)(int))si_handler;
-+      action.sa_flags = 0;
-+#endif
- 
-       sigaction(SIGSEGV, &action, NULL);
-       sigaction(SIGQUIT, &action, NULL);
diff -r d3df9cadaf32 -r b33914e2ec86 graphics/swfdec/patches/patch-ac
--- a/graphics/swfdec/patches/patch-ac  Sat Jun 04 10:20:22 2005 +0000
+++ /dev/null   Thu Jan 01 00:00:00 1970 +0000
@@ -1,24 +0,0 @@
-$NetBSD: patch-ac,v 1.2 2004/01/22 12:48:32 jmmv Exp $
-
---- pixbuf-loader/Makefile.in.orig     2003-02-05 21:37:46.000000000 +0100
-+++ pixbuf-loader/Makefile.in
-@@ -102,7 +102,7 @@ SDL_CFLAGS = @SDL_CFLAGS@
- SDL_LIBS = @SDL_LIBS@
- STRIP = @STRIP@
- SWF_CFLAGS = @SWF_CFLAGS@
--SWF_LIBS = @SWF_LIBS@
-+SWF_LIBS = `pkg-config --libs swfdec glib-2.0` -lz
- VERSION = @VERSION@
- X_CFLAGS = @X_CFLAGS@
- X_EXTRA_LIBS = @X_EXTRA_LIBS@
-@@ -391,10 +391,6 @@ uninstall-am: uninstall-info-am uninstal
- 
- 
- install-data-local: 
--      if [ -z "$(DESTDIR)" ] ; then \
--        $(mkinstalldirs) $(DESTDIR)$(sysconfdir)/gtk-2.0 ; \



Home | Main Index | Thread Index | Old Index